Java, a robust and versatile programming language, has found significant applications in the hotel industry, transforming the way hospitality businesses operate. The integration of Java into various aspects of hotel management offers a plethora of advantages, streamlining operations and enhancing the guest experience. From booking systems to customer relationship management (CRM) platforms, Java serves as the backbone for numerous applications that are crucial in this sector.
One of the most prominent uses of Java in the hotel industry is in reservation systems. With Java’s platform independence, hotel chains can implement booking engines that function seamlessly across different operating systems and devices. This ensures that customers can make reservations with ease, whether they are using a desktop computer, tablet, or smartphone. Java's object-oriented programming capabilities allow for the creation of efficient and scalable applications, catering to a large volume of bookings without compromising performance.
Java-based applications also play a pivotal role in property management systems (PMS). These systems are crucial for managing a hotel's daily operations, including front desk management, room inventory tracking, and housekeeping schedules. Java enables the development of reliable PMS solutions that provide real-time data access, allowing hotel staff to make informed decisions quickly. For instance, room availability can be updated instantly across all platforms, reducing the risk of over-bookings and enhancing overall operational efficiency.
The integration of Java into CRM systems is another game-changer for the hotel industry. With effective customer relationship management, hotels can store and analyze guest data, helping to personalize services and improve customer satisfaction. Java allows for sophisticated algorithms to be implemented that can analyze booking patterns, preferences, and feedback, enabling hotels to tailor their marketing strategies and enhance guest loyalty. Additionally, integration with various third-party services and platforms via APIs (Application Programming Interfaces) is simplified thanks to Java’s widespread adoption in the IT industry.
Moreover, Java’s security features enhance the safety of transactions and data management in hotels. Given the sensitive nature of customer information, including personal identification and payment details, Java provides built-in mechanisms that protect against data breaches. Secure access controls, encryption, and compliance with regulations such as GDPR (General Data Protection Regulation) are easier to achieve with Java, ensuring that hotels can build trust with their guests.
Implementing Java in the hotel industry also supports the rise of mobile applications. With the growing trend of mobile bookings and interactions, hotels are leveraging Java to create user-friendly mobile apps that allow guests to book rooms, check-in, and access services from their smartphones. These applications often incorporate features such as room service requests, direct messaging with hotel staff, and feedback submission, further enhancing the guest experience. The flexibility of Java enables developers to continually update and improve these applications, adapting to changing customer needs and technological advancements.
In addition to operational improvements, Java aids in inventory control and supply chain management for hotels. With proper tracking of supplies, from linens to food and beverages, Java-based systems help hotels minimize waste and optimize purchasing. By analyzing inventory data and usage trends, hotels can make smarter decisions regarding stock levels, contributing to overall cost savings and efficiency.
The use of Java in business intelligence tools also empowers hotel managers to make data-driven decisions. With the ability to analyze sales figures, occupancy rates, and operational costs, Java allows hotel management teams to generate insightful reports that inform strategic planning. These tools help identify trends, forecast demand, and make adjustments to pricing strategies, ultimately supporting the hotel’s bottom line.
Moreover, with the rise of smart technologies and IoT (Internet of Things) devices in hotels, Java is playing a significant role in integrating these systems. By allowing smart TVs, room controls, and security systems to communicate seamlessly, Java enhances the overall guest experience through convenient and automated features. Guests can control various aspects of their room environment via their smartphones or smart assistants, creating a more personalized stay.
Training and support for hotel staff are also streamlined through Java-based systems. Employee management solutions built using Java can facilitate training modules, performance evaluations, and scheduling. These systems can incorporate e-learning components, allowing staff to enhance their skills at their own pace and improving service quality over time.
